What are some common challenges faced by manufacturing project engineers during project implementation?
Career: Manufacturing Project Engineer
Manufacturing Project Engineers often encounter challenges such as managing tight deadlines, coordinating with cross-functional teams, and adapting to unexpected technical issues during project implementation. Balancing cost, quality, and production efficiency can be demanding, especially when integrating new technologies or processes. Effective communication and strong organizational skills are crucial, as you’ll frequently collaborate with production, quality assurance, and supply chain teams to ensure project success.
